A Stunning Russian Choir!

Male Choir of St. Petersburg

FRIDAY, FEBRUARY 27, 2009, 8PM

The Male Choir of St. Petersburg consists of 25 musicians and performs both sacred and secular music, folk songs, and the music of Russia's foremost composers including Tchaikovsky, Rachmaninoff, Rimsky-Korsakov, and Mussorgsky. This is their first tour of the United States.

Hear the Complete Brandenburg Concertos!

The Academy of Ancient Music

RICHARD EGARR, MUSIC DIRECTOR
SATURDAY, MARCH 28, 2009, 8PM

Johann Sebastian Bach: The Six Brandenburg Concertos

The Academy of Ancient Music is one of the world's foremost period-instrument orchestras. Concerts across six continents and over 250 recordings demonstrate their pre-eminence in the music of the Baroque and Classical periods. The Ultimate Boys Choir!

Vienna Choir Boys

TUESDAY, OCTOBER 21, 2008, 7:30PM

Now in its 509th year, this extraordinary musical ensemble has entertained and moved millions of people. Each year, the group visits virtually all the European countries and is frequently in Asia, Australia, and the Americas. The Vienna Choir Boys continue to be at the pinnacle of choral performance.

Music of Tchaikovsky, Shostakovich, and Glinka!

The Dublin Philharmonic Orchestra

DEREK GLEESON, MUSIC DIRECTOR AND CONDUCTOR
FINGHIN COLLINS, PIANO
SUNDAY, JANUARY 25, 2009, 7:30PM

Glinka: Russlan and Ludmilla Overture
Shostakovich: Piano Concerto No. 2
Tchaikovsky: Symphony No. 4

Founded in the 19th century, the Dublin Philharmonic performs throughout Ireland. Under Derek Gleeson, the orchestra has recorded classical and modern repertoire as well as film scores. In 2009 the Dublin Philharmonic Orchestra undertakes its first tour of the United States.
